Quote from br8n :
Maybe this is a silly question, but can they carry video-over-USB, or at least data transfer, or are they purely charging cables??
The cable is rated for 480mbps so it can absolutely transfer data. It generally cannot be used as a video cable for a monitor as it doesn't have the internal hardware necessary.

If you know you need and can use a usb C cable to run video to a screen you want a 20gbps cable generally, though they go down to 4gbps, just depends on what you need to drive and its outputs.

but yes this cable will work great for charging and just fine for normal data transfer!

Oh it's not just charging vs. data either. Even within charging, the USB-C connector is all over the place. Some USB-C devices will not support the power delivery protocol, so it cannot be charged at higher wattage and will not work with USB-C to USB-C cables, only USB-A to USB-C. There is absolutely no way to tell if a port is one of those. Most infuriatingly, the only thing the device needed to do to support PD is add a cheap little resistor. Still, companies want to cheap out on that.
On an even more annoying note, even within the Power Delivery protocol, there are certain charging profiles that don't work with certain devices. Even if you have a 45w wall brick, if that brick doesn't support 20v output (achieves 45w with 15v 3A instead), then it won't work with a laptop designed to charge at 20v. This could explain why some people have compatibility issues with power banks/wall bricks and certain devices when both seem to be functioning correctly.
Then there's Samsung's turbo charge mode that requires PPS.
It's all over the place and none of these things are labeled correctly at all. Everything I typed, I actually learned the hard way, not through research. I'm sure there are even more incompatibilities, but this is everything I've encountered with my devices.
